http://developingteachers.com

"...a bold attempt at integration, offering materials which not only complement each other but also may be used in class or for self-study purposes.
The Vocabulary book follows a clear lexical syllabus...Particularly impressive are the exercises which ask the learner to choose and manipulate vocabulary, based on the knowledge that new items take time to learn.
Grammar is explained clearly...The language of explanation is carefully graded.
The Reading and Writing book concentrates on contemporary language, including texts and tasks based on email, internet and text messages...There are excellent links to the vocabulary book, particularly where learners are encouraged to read and use language in chunks.
The listening texts are authentic or semi-authentic, not too long and include some new language. The speaking tasks are varied, and carefully designed so that learners receive appropriate input before producing language and to avoid demotivating performances.
An excellent set in all respects and highly recommended."
